Wash. Luxury Hotel Owner Sues Fireman’s Fund for COVID-19 Coverage
October 14, 2020
DOCUMENTS
- Complaint
SEATTLE — A Washington luxury hotel owner has accused Fireman’s Fund Insurance Co. of denying its claim for coverage of COVID-19-related business interruption losses in bad faith, arguing that it sustained “direct physical loss of use or damage” to the insured properties.
In an Oct. 13 complaint filed in the U.S. District Court for the Western District of Washington, Worthy Hotels Inc. and its affiliates contend that they suffered physical loss of use of the covered properties for their intended purpose caused by the risk and/or actual presence of COVID-19 and/or related government closure orders.
